Finally! Building Authority Approval Z-14.4-532 for the EJOT Solar Fastener

EJOT are the first in the industry to offer a Building Authorities approved screw to fasten elevations for solar and photovoltaic installations. EJOT took on the lead role in the booming market for solar systems regarding proven solutions for this task.


EJOT® The quality connection The EJOT solar fastener is a combination of reliable EJOT screw with special connecting threads. This design guarantees the easy assembly and secure fixing of the solar and photovoltaic installations.
The fastener has proven its usefulness according to the applicable building laws, with extensive tests at accredited institutions. After a certificate of conformity for these tests it was then presented to the DIBt (German Institute for Building Technology) and a building inspection approval for the fastener was awarded. The approval information contains, in addition to assembly advice, compliance indications, intended use etc. also the necessary statistical design loads for the dimensioning.

The following advantages result from the use of approved products: 

  • constant quality
  • applicable as a proof of usability for the testing authorities and insurances 
  • statistical parameters provide a proof of the bearing capacity without assumptions 
  • no verification of the usability of the item necessary for every single case 
  • The planners are saved a lot of detailed work
